FEMA AE flood zones are high-risk flood zones in Florida that are subject to flooding but not wave action. Construction in AE zones must comply with the Florida Building Code's flood zone requirements. This guide explains the AE zone construction requirements.

AE Zone Elevation Requirements

Buildings in AE zones must have their lowest floor elevated to or above the BFE plus the required freeboard. The lowest floor is the lowest floor of the habitable space — not the top of the foundation. For slab-on-grade construction, the top of the slab must be at or above the BFE plus freeboard. For elevated construction (stem wall or pile), the bottom of the lowest floor framing must be at or above the BFE plus freeboard. AE Zone Foundation Options

Buildings in AE zones can use any of the following foundation types: - **Slab-on-grade:** The top of the slab must be at or above the BFE plus freeboard. This is only practical when the BFE is close to existing grade. - **Stem wall:** A CMU or concrete stem wall elevates the floor above grade. Practical for BFEs up to 4–5 feet above grade. - **Pile foundation:** Prestressed concrete piles or helical piles elevate the floor above grade. Practical for any BFE. Frequently Asked Questions

What foundation types are allowed in an AE flood zone?

AE zones allow slab-on-grade (if the slab can be elevated to the BFE), stem wall, and pile foundations. The most appropriate foundation type depends on the BFE and the site conditions.

Do I need flood insurance in an AE zone?

Flood insurance is required for federally backed mortgages on properties in AE zones. Even without a mortgage requirement, flood insurance is strongly recommended for AE zone properties.
